Azeroth Armory: Smash Day
"Smash Day" is the day where we shoot the fun part: breaking things! Tony doesn't just make props out of these builds. Every piece is a fully functioning weapon and the crew demonstrates that by chopping and breaking things with the finished product.
Before all of the smashing begins, glamour shots for both weapons were shot before we scuff them up in the process of smashing props. Two weapons were crafted for this project: "Ashbringer" (pictured above) and "Doomhammer" (pictured below).
In addition to the weapons, the crew also produced a full set of Demon Hunter armor to help promote the launch of that playable class just before WoW: Legion. The weapon shown was not crafted for this shoot, but it was forged by the same blacksmith. The crew brought it along to add a nice finishing touch to the look of the costume pieces.
With everything in place, it was time to break stuff! I used the same high-speed setup as the previous shoot days in the workshop, but with a lot less danger. Instead of trying to wait for the right moment, I used burst photography to pick and choose the best moments of each break.
The biggest challenge I had as the set photographer was the haze on set and staying out of the way of the video shot, but getting the best angle possible. I had to quickly coordinate my position with the DP to make sure everything was set, and in post production I took advantage of Lightroom's dehazing feature along with some heavy duty color correction to clear up the final shots.

With the Azeroth Armory series, there's ALWAYS a mascot willing to sacrifice themselves for the greater good. This Murloc, for example...
After the breaking was done and the set cleaned up, we brought on the Demon Hunter for their glamour shots and a few fun poses to show off the full costume. I also added some basic effects for the eyes to better represent the in game characters.
